Linux下打开Emacs出现乱码的解决方法

seo优化 2025-04-23 19:58www.1681989.comseo排名

Emacs被誉为最优秀的代码编辑器之一,它在Lux系统下的用户群体尤为庞大。由于默认编码与文档编码的不匹配,许多用户在打开文件时常常遇到乱码问题。今天,推火网小编就为大家介绍在Lux系统下解决Emacs乱码问题的两种方法。

对于新手来说,解决Emacs乱码问题可以通过以下两种途径:

方法一:手动指定编码

当遇到乱码问题时,你可以尝试使用快捷键C-x r(或者M-x revert-buffer-with-coding-system)来重新读入文件并使用指定的编码。乱码问题通常是由于在Emacs中使用lat或utf8编码,而打开的文档却是gb2312编码所致。如果你不确定文件的编码类型,可以尝试使用tab键进行编码类型补齐。你也可以通过file 文件名或者enca文件名来查看文件的编码。

例如,我选择了gb18030-unix编码,转码后的效果十分理想。

方法二:使用unicad插件

另一种解决方法是下载unicad.el插件并保存到相应的目录,例如在.emacs中配置的my-elisp文件夹。然后在.emacs文件中声明(require ‘unicad),这样下次打开文档时,unicad插件会自动判断文件的编码类型,非常便捷。

以上就是在Lux系统下解决Emacs乱码问题的两种方法。如果你在Emacs中也遇到了乱码问题,不妨尝试一下这两种方法。相信它们能够帮助你顺利解决乱码困扰,提升你的编程体验。

通过这两种方法,你可以轻松地在Lux系统下使用Emacs编辑器,避免因编码不匹配而导致的乱码问题。希望这些解决方案对你有所帮助,让你的编程工作更加顺畅!

Copyright © 2016-2025 www.1681989.com 推火网 版权所有 Power by